BTW: where are the facts / data that suggests dual row bearings fail because they don't get enough oil. Remember these failing bearings are sealed and therefore internally lubricated. Pumping external oil onto a sealed bearing won't help much if at all. The fix is to replace the OEM bearing with an unsealed dual row one. To date, there are no dual row LN Retrofit bearings failures even though these retrofits are splash oil lubricated. DOF contends it will extend the operating lifetimes of unsealed bearings, but the vendors won't say by how much. If they have, I haven't been able to find the estimate.
